Wasn't the last system to support Cyberdog OS 7.6.1?

Nope! I was using Cybie well into OS 9.1 days... You just have to go out of your way to install OpenDoc and all the parts.


Cybie was neat. I really liked the way it provided an Internet "suite" of FTP, Web, email, gopher, and Telnet along with an interesting bookmark manager...

I stopped using it because OpenDoc leaks memory like a sieve. And there was some other reason that I can't think of right now...
